Output 8f5938841d705998fb7ca6e70c37dc9d815bdee539a52f898e5a9dfd626017f8:0

value
43082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ae2a6a2c87626347ea004e0952f38fedf091b27 OP_EQUAL
address
39yaFnoo6Y4uBhxij7GpFiAEGgbTbZLPgk
transaction
8f5938841d705998fb7ca6e70c37dc9d815bdee539a52f898e5a9dfd626017f8
confirmations
213756
spent
true